       AN ACT in relation to granting Eric Zausner tier IV status  in  the  New
         York state and local employees' retirement system
         THE  PEOPLE OF THE STATE OF NEW YORK, REPRESENTED IN SENATE AND ASSEM-
       BLY, DO ENACT AS FOLLOWS:
    1    Section 1. Notwithstanding any other provision of law,  Eric  Zausner,
    2  who  is  a  member of the New York state and local employees' retirement
    3  system having tier V status, and who, is employed by the  Nassau  county
    4  board  of elections and has been so employed since January 20, 2011, and
    5  who, prior to his current employment, was employed by the Nassau  county
    6  board of elections on a continuous part-time basis for the period begin-
    7  ning  June  25,  2003  and ending July 6, 2005, and who, for reasons not
    8  ascribable to his own negligence, failed to become a member of  the  New
    9  York  state  and  local  employees'  retirement system on June 25, 2003,
   10  shall be deemed to have been a member of such retirement system on  June
   11  25,  2003, having tier IV status with every right, benefit and privilege
   12  which would have been available to him on such date, if,  on  or  before
   13  December  31,  2015, he shall file a written request to that effect with
   14  the state comptroller.
   15    S 2. No contributions made to the New York state and local  employees'
   16  retirement  system  by Eric Zausner shall be returned or refunded to him
   17  pursuant to this act.
   18    S 3. All past service costs associated with the implementation of this
   19  act shall be borne by the county of Nassau.
   20    S 4. This act shall take effect immediately.
         FISCAL NOTE.--Pursuant to Legislative Law, Section 50:
         This bill will grant Tier 4 status in the New  York  State  and  Local
       Employees'  Retirement  System  to Eric Zausner, a current Tier 5 member
       employed by Nassau County, by changing his date of  membership  to  June
       25, 2003. There will be no refund of member contributions.

         If this legislation is enacted during the 2015 legislative session, we
       anticipate that there will be an increase of approximately $2,800 in the
       annual contributions of the State of New York for the fiscal year ending
       March  31,  2016.  In  future  years, this cost will vary as the billing
       rates and salary of Eric Zausner change.
         In addition to the annual contributions discussed above, there will be
       an  immediate  past  service  cost of approximately $9,520 which will be
       borne by Nassau County as a one-time payment. This estimate is based  on
       the assumption that payment will be made February 1, 2016.
